Proposal
T16 Mature Common Ash - Remove deadwood and any branches affected by ash dieback or otherwise assessed as unsafe. T17 Early Mature Common Ash: Reduce the lateral crown spread on the boundary/neighbouring property side by approximately 2-3 metres, pruning back to suitable growth points and maintaining a natural, balanced crown. Remove minor deadwood and any branches affected by ash dieback or otherwise assessed as unsafe. T18 Early Mature Common Ash: Remove deadwood and any branches affected by ash dieback or otherwise assessed as unsafe. T21 Mature Sycamore: Removal of lowest limb while retaining the tree.

About tree works applications
Applications for works to trees cover protected trees: consent under a tree preservation order, or six weeks notice for trees in a conservation area. More in our guide to planning application types.
